NSFAS Bursaries Are Available For Those Studying At TVET Colleges and Universities



The National Student Financial Aid Scheme (NSFAS) is actually a South African govt initiative geared toward furnishing financial assistance to suitable students who are not able to find the money for to pay for for their tertiary education.

It is a crucial useful resource for improving upon usage of better schooling for underprivileged students. In this article’s an outline:

Objective

NSFAS funds students studying at general public universities and Technical and Vocational Education and Training (TVET) colleges. The principal aim is to create tertiary training obtainable to college students from poor and working-class households.

Eligibility Standards

To qualify for NSFAS funding, learners ought to:

* Be South African citizens.
* Be enrolled or desiring to enroll in a public university or TVET college in South Africa.
* Come from a home which has a combined yearly cash flow of R350,000 or less.
* For students living with disabilities, the yearly household profits threshold is R600,000.
* Be initial-time university students or continuing students who meet up with tutorial effectiveness conditions.

What NSFAS Covers

NSFAS gives in depth funding that features:

Tuition Costs: Fully compensated in accordance with the establishment's specifications.
Accommodation: Either} institution-provided or private accommodation inside authorized limitations.
Study how to upload documents on nsfas Materials: A set sum for books and other studying resources.
Living Allowance: For meals, transportation, as well as other necessities.
Transportation Fees: read more For college students commuting from home, nearly 40km with the institution.

Repayment of NSFAS Loans

NSFAS used to operate as a loan scheme for university students. However, since 2018, it has become a bursary program for qualifying students.

Loan Repayment (Old System): Graduates with outstanding loans repay once they secure employment and earn above a certain threshold.
Bursary Conditions (New System): Students who complete their studies do not have to repay the funding. However, those who fail to complete may need to repay some of the funds.

Institutions Supported

However in 2024 another version was added where student check here loans were again available, this time for missing-middle students. They are defined as those whose household income annually between R350,000 and R600,000.
